Regular Season Round 12: Urania Milano - Faenza 74-64
Date: December 15, 2018
Leading Faenza (10-2) recorded its second loss on the court of fifth ranked Urania Milano. Visitors were defeated by Urania Milano 74-64. It ended at the same time the four-game winning streak of Faenza. Urania Milano made 19-of-24 charity shots (79.2 percent) during the game. Their players were unselfish on offense dishing 25 assists comparing to just 12 passes made by Faenza's players. Faenza was plagued by 24 personal fouls down the stretch. The winners were led by center Giorgio Piunti (205-90) who had that evening a double-double by scoring 26 points and 11 rebounds (on 9-of-10 shooting from the field) and the former international guard Riccardo Santolamazza (195-83) supported him with 11 points and 8 assists. Urania Milano's coach Davide Villa allowed to play the deep bench players saving starting five for next games. Even 18 points by point guard Carlo Fumagalli (188-96) did not help to save the game for Faenza. Swingman Gioacchino Chiappelli (198-91) added 10 points and 6 rebounds. Four Faenza players scored in double figures. Urania Milano (8-4) moved-up to third place in B, which they share with Ozzano and Padova. Faenza at the other side still keeps top position with two games lost. Urania Milano will play against Orzinuovi (#7) on the road in the next round. Faenza will play against Crema (#14) and hopes to get back on the winning track.
